Is mouse bait box profitable to sell on Amazon United Kingdom?
The niche generates £48K/yr across 21 tracked products. 2 of 4 products launched in the last 360 days are still selling. 90-day search growth is -3.5%. Flapen's verdict: Skip it (46/100).
How competitive is the mouse bait box niche?
7 brands and 55 sellers compete. The top 5 products take 60% of clicks and top 5 brands hold 95% of demand.
What do buyers complain about in mouse bait box?
Top complaints mined from reviews: Functionality-Overall, Pest/Insect Control, Size-Overall. The return rate is 0.8%.
When does demand for mouse bait box peak?
Demand peaks in Nov–Dec; the busiest month runs 2.6× the quietest.
What does it cost to enter the mouse bait box niche?
Listings span £2.96–£16.20; the average listing price is £10.75 (sweet spot $15–$100). The average incumbent carries 1,180 reviews — the moat a new listing must climb.
